Today was my first meeting with a staff member from Canada World Youth -CWY- (http://www.cwy-jcm.org/), a famous organization which offers international educational programs to young people aged 17 to 24.

I met with Nadia Karina Ponce Morales, the program manager of CWY in the Quebec province, she is open-minded, dynamic, enthusiastic and happy to know about TakingITGlobal and to have me in their offices starting from next september.

So, CWY will be my host organization for year 3 of the CLC program, I am sure the partnership will be successful for TIG and CWY since they focus both on youth and they help them be involved in their communities. If CLC promotes and supports youth participation in Canada, Canada World Youth, created in 1971, has many programs that aim to help the youth develop their professional and interpersonal skills, make new friends, discover an other country and culture and improve their ability to work in a team.

With CWY, 18 young people from different cultures spend a total of six months away from their homes, living together for three months in a Canadian community and three months in a
community in one of CWY’s partner countries in Africa, Asia, the Caribbean, Eastern Europe or Latin America. (for more info, visit: http://www.cwy-jcm.org/en/aboutus/download/71971_BrochAN.pdf)

During the program of CWY, the participants live in host families and work as volunteers. Highly volunteering by the way :) (it is the title of a poem that I wrote recently, it was featured in the panorama).
An example of the activities can be preparing activities for World Food Day in Jamaica. Isn't it an exciting and learning experience?

The CWY program equipped thousands of young people with many useful skills for the future, a better understanding of global issues, and the ability and desire to contribute to the well-being

Today, I can celebrate a special aniversary: I have been an active member of TakingITGlobal for more than one year, and it is just the beginning, but I learned a lot, I learned to connect with others, share experiences and knowledge, discover other cultures in different countries or even islands like Vanuatu (btw, thanks Joel Kalpram for your messages).

Furthermore, from January 2008, I have been the Montreal Youth Engagement Coordinator and I am enjoying this position that inspired me a lot and is still inspiring me. Imagine, youth in different parts of the Quebec Province are involved in their communities, some of them are not since they don't have the tools to get informed, inspired and then involved, what I am doing with Creating Local Connections Canada (http://projects.takingitglobal.org/clccanada) is an effort to help youth become more aware of global issues like Climate Change, HIV-Aids, access to education or fighting poverty.

Moreover, I helped many new TIG members to get familiarized with the TIG website, I wrote new poems (Highly volunteering ! : http://www.takingitglobal.org/express/panorama/article.html?ContentID=19053 and Highly Green Movement: http://www.takingitglobal.org/express/panorama/article.html?ContentID=19095)

I was also very active on the TIG Website during the last months (2nd Most Active TIG Member), the idea is to inspire and encourage Francophone and Montreal's TIG Members to be active on the TIG platform as well.

I can't tell you guys all what I did as a TIG member, but, in a nutshell, my experience with TIG and CLC is one of the best experiences in my life. Hope it is the same for you.
